Ordinals
beta
Sat 1821653129597904
decimal
617322.629597904
degree
0°197322′426″629597904‴
percentile
86.74538721912968%
name
ayfwnmoqorx
cycle
0
epoch
2
period
306
block
617322
offset
629597904
timestamp
2020-02-14 06:11:25 UTC
rarity
common
prev
next